Ah yes, the Pickup Truck. Americans have had a love affair with the utility vehicle for over a century and thanks to manufacturers like Ford, the supply has always been there to meet the demand. Ford began its truck program back in 1908 with the Ford Model TT evolving into some of the most recognizable and beloved trucks the auto community has seen. While the 1930s were a decade of financial strain due to the Depression, Ford experienced remarkable success with their durable and cost-effective trucks outselling Chevrolet in 1935 by nearly 300,000 units!
